首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

错误:通过将.txt文件复制到postgres表,整数“”的输入语法无效

这个错误是由于在将.txt文件复制到postgres表时,整数字段的输入语法无效导致的。通常情况下,整数字段需要提供有效的整数值作为输入。

要解决这个问题,可以按照以下步骤进行操作:

  1. 确保.txt文件中的整数字段的值是有效的整数。检查文件内容,确保整数字段没有空值或非数字字符。
  2. 在将.txt文件复制到postgres表之前,可以使用文本编辑器或脚本语言(如Python)对文件进行预处理,确保整数字段的值是有效的整数。可以使用正则表达式或其他方法进行验证和转换。
  3. 在将.txt文件复制到postgres表时,确保使用正确的输入语法来指定整数字段。在postgres的COPY命令中,可以使用DELIMITER和NULL参数来指定字段分隔符和空值的表示方式。确保这些参数与.txt文件的格式相匹配。
  4. 如果仍然遇到问题,可以检查postgres表的结构和字段定义,确保整数字段的数据类型与.txt文件中的数据类型相匹配。如果需要,可以修改表结构以适应正确的数据类型。

总结:

在将.txt文件复制到postgres表时,确保整数字段的输入语法有效,并且与文件中的数据类型相匹配。进行数据预处理和验证,使用正确的输入语法和参数来复制数据。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券